Preparation
- In a medium saucepan, melt the butter over medium heat until it turns a beautiful golden brown and starts to smell nutty—about 5 minutes.
- In a large bowl, combine brown sugar, granulated sugar, and coffee granules. Pour the brown butter into this mix and stir until well combined.
- Add the egg and vanilla extract to the mixture, blending until smooth.
- In a separate bowl, whisk together flour, baking soda, and salt. Gradually add to the wet ingredients, stirring just until combined.
- Gently fold in the toffee bits and chocolate chips, if using.
- Cover the dough and let it chill in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es.
Baking
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
- Scoop out tablespoon-sized portions of dough and place them on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
- Bake for 10-12 minutes or until the edges are golden brown.
- Let them cool for a few minutes before serving.
Notes
Keep an eye on the butter while browning as it can burn quickly. If you can't find toffee bits, you can use chopped toffee candy bars. These cookies freeze well; shape dough into balls and freeze before baking.
